**Service Account: reminder-runner**

The clinic appointment reminder job at Bramleigh Health runs nightly at 02:15 under the `reminder-runner` service account. It reads tomorrow's bookings from Schedulo and queues SMS batches through our dispatch layer. The account has read-only scope on patient schedules and write scope on the outbound queue only. Logs land in the `reminders-nightly` stream. If you need to run it manually during your contract, authenticate against the dispatch layer using the key below.

API key for yahig-tadup: kto7_ubizbYm

Garage feed checklist — Parkline Occupancy. The Stallway sensor gateway pushes counts every 30s to the ingest node. If counts flatline, restart the collector, then verify the poller in the Driftgate console. Before restarting, confirm the .env on the ingest box is complete. The collector's API credential goes on the next line.

env line for fafof-fahag: LEDGER_TOKEN5=f8790

Penhallow Industries has tabled a term sheet for co-developing the Strathmere battery platform. Headline terms: shared IP with field-of-use carve-outs, 45M development commitment over three years, milestone-based payments, and mutual exclusivity in the Carvell region. Open issues: termination triggers and royalty step-downs. Negotiation lead is H. Duvalier; next round is scheduled for the 14th. Redlines live in the legal workspace. The underlying strategic intent is captured in the confidential note below.

board note of fafog-yahap: Project Rusdor slips by a full year because of the audit delay.